What Is Diphtheria?

Diphtheria is a bacterial infection that affects the nose and throat, and can cause breathing difficulties, heart problems and nerve damage if untreated. It spreads through respiratory droplets and remains more common in parts of Asia, Africa, Eastern Europe and South America.

Do I Need the Diphtheria Vaccine?

A booster is recommended if you are travelling to a region where diphtheria remains common, or if it has been more than 10 years since your last dose. Your pharmacist will check your vaccination history at your consultation.

When Should I Get Vaccinated?

Ideally at least 2 weeks before you travel, to allow protection to build up.

How Many Doses Do I Need?

If you have been vaccinated before, a single booster dose is usually sufficient. If this is your first vaccination or your history is unclear, you may need a fuller course — we will advise after reviewing your records.

Side Effects of the Diphtheria Vaccine

Side effects are usually mild: soreness at the injection site, or feeling generally unwell for a day or two.

How long does diphtheria protection last?

A full course or booster typically protects for around 10 years.

Is diphtheria serious?

Yes — it can cause severe breathing problems and other complications, and can be fatal if untreated.
